We have just got back from a weekend in Rome. We stayed at this hotel as part of an EasyJet holiday package. The hotel room we had was room 101 in the main hotel building. The room was very basic. Didn’t look like the pictures. However, Nice big bed, hairdryer, safe, mini bar, room service, hangers and some bathroom condiments. There was no tea/coffee in the room and the shower was tiny. We literally just slept in this hotel as we were out all day everyday exploring Rome. Given 4 stars because I slept like a dream, the beds were incredibly comfortable. After a full day walking in Rome the bed was exactly what I needed. Breakfast was okay. Didn’t have your basic apple and orange juice. There was pineapple juice and a blood orange juice. Some pastry’s, bread, fruit and yogurts with cereal and meats. Wouldn’t say the breakfast set us up for the day. The wasps in the garden were everywhere so we couldn’t sit in the garden, they did venture into the actual breakfast room which was annoying. Staff were wonderful and incredibly friendly. English spoken aswell. There was a city tax you pay when you leave which was 6 euros per night, per person. They also store some card details incase you use the minibar in your room and they also ask for your passport to scan (which is pretty standard everywhere). They have a baggage room so you can store your bags. It was slightly out of the way the hotel and a fair bit to walk. However, we didn’t mind that as there was incredibly buildings to see along the way. All in all a nice enough stay.
